The typical home in Penny Stone Road last sold for £161,500. Over the past decade prices are +71% in cash — but +19% once inflation is stripped out.
Cash prices in Penny Stone Road look like they’ve climbed +71% in ten years. Adjust for inflation and the real gain is +19% — the difference is inflation, not wealth. Toggle the chart to see it.

The median sold price in Penny Stone Road is £161,500, based on 10 sales recorded by HM Land Registry.
Over the past decade prices in Penny Stone Road are +71% in cash terms, and +19% after adjusting for inflation (ONS CPIH).
We don't yet have enough matched EPC floor-area data to publish a reliable price per square metre for Penny Stone Road.
Figures update monthly from HM Land Registry. The most recent sale here was recorded on 19 July 2024; the latest two months may be incomplete while sales register.
